How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 29577?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 29577 Studio Apartments | $1,333 | $875 | $2,393 |
| 29577 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,458 | $1,000 | $2,335 |
| 29577 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,766 | $1,066 | $8,369 |
| 29577 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,576 | $1,576 | $13,471 |
| 29577 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,357 | $2,030 | $4,104 |
